Skip to content

How Many Years To Become An Web Developer? (9 Simple Questions Answered)

Discover the Surprising Truth About How Long it Takes to Become a Web Developer – 9 Simple Questions Answered!

The amount of time it takes to become a web developer depends on a variety of factors, such as the level of technical skills required, the amount of coding knowledge needed, the programming languages used, and whether or not a computer science degree is pursued. Generally, it takes at least one year to learn the HTML/CSS basics and gain a basic understanding of JavaScript, and then additional time to master more complex coding languages and database management systems. With dedication and hard work, it is possible to become a web developer in two to three years.

Contents

  1. What Technical Skills Are Required To Become A Web Developer?
  2. How Much Time Is Needed To Master Web Development?
  3. What Coding Knowledge Do You Need For Web Development?
  4. Which Programming Languages Are Used In Web Development?
  5. Is A Computer Science Degree Necessary For Becoming A Web Developer?
  6. What Are The HTML/CSS Basics Every Beginner Should Know About?
  7. How Can JavaScript Understanding Help With Becoming An Expert Web Developer?
  8. What Role Does Database Management System Play In Developing Websites And Applications?
  9. Common Mistakes And Misconceptions

What Technical Skills Are Required To Become A Web Developer?

To become a web developer, you will need to have a strong understanding of the following technical skills: JavaScript, Responsive Design, Web Frameworks, Database Management Systems, Version Control Systems, Content Management System (CMS), Cross-Browser Compatibility Testing, Search Engine Optimization (SEO), Security and Privacy Protocols, Networking Fundamentals, API Integration, Mobile Development, Testing and Debugging, and Problem Solving.


How Much Time Is Needed To Master Web Development?

Mastering web development requires dedication and a significant amount of time. It typically takes several years to become a proficient web developer, as one must understand the fundamentals of web development, develop expertise in coding languages such as HTML, CSS and JavaScript, acquire knowledge of frameworks and libraries, build proficiency with databases and server-side technologies, create responsive websites and applications, utilize debugging tools to troubleshoot code issues, implement best practices for security and performance optimization, keep up with emerging trends in the field, work on real-world projects to gain experience, dedicate time to practice regularly, and establish a portfolio of work.


What Coding Knowledge Do You Need For Web Development?

In order to become a web developer, you need to have a good understanding of coding languages such as JavaScript, jQuery, AJAX, PHP, and MySQL. You should also be familiar with responsive design, cross-browser compatibility, version control systems (Git), frameworks (Angular, React, Vue), object-oriented programming (OOP), web application security, API integration and development, server administration & deployment, and search engine optimization (SEO).


Which Programming Languages Are Used In Web Development?

The programming languages commonly used in web development are JavaScript, PHP, Python, Ruby, Java, C#, SQL, TypeScript, Swift, GoLang, Rust, Kotlin, Objective-C, and R Programming.


Is A Computer Science Degree Necessary For Becoming A Web Developer?

No, a computer science degree is not necessarily required for becoming a web developer. However, having a degree in computer science can provide a strong foundation in the technical knowledge, programming languages, coding skills, software development, database management, networking concepts, algorithms and data structures, mathematics and logic, problem-solving abilities, analytical thinking, creative solutions, computer architecture, and software engineering that are necessary for web development. Additionally, having a degree in computer science can provide a competitive edge in the job market.


What Are The HTML/CSS Basics Every Beginner Should Know About?

Every beginner should know the basics of HTML/CSS, including CSS selectors, CSS properties, web page structure, semantic markup, responsive design principles, box model concept, Document Object Model (DOM), Cascading Style Sheets (CSS), fonts and typography, color theory and usage, media queries, cross-browser compatibility, web accessibility standards, and HTML/CSS best practices.


How Can JavaScript Understanding Help With Becoming An Expert Web Developer?

JavaScript understanding can be a key factor in becoming an expert web developer. Having a strong understanding of JavaScript syntax and coding principles can help developers write efficient code and create interactive websites. Additionally, knowledge of JavaScript can be used to build dynamic user interfaces, develop complex applications, utilize modern technologies, integrate APIs into projects, optimize website performance, and troubleshoot issues. All of these skills are essential for becoming an expert web developer.


What Role Does Database Management System Play In Developing Websites And Applications?

Database Management Systems (DBMS) play a critical role in developing websites and applications. DBMS provide the necessary tools to store, manipulate, and analyze data. Structured Query Language (SQL) is used to interact with the database and perform data manipulation and analysis. Relational database models are used to store data in a structured format. Security and access control are also important components of DBMS, as they ensure that only authorized users can access the data. Performance optimization is also a key feature of DBMS, as it helps to ensure that the website or application runs smoothly. Additionally, DBMS provide scalability of databases, automated backup systems, data integrity maintenance, indexing for faster search results, transaction processing capabilities, cloud-based database solutions, data warehousing strategies, NoSQL databases, and big data analytics.


Common Mistakes And Misconceptions

  1. Mistake: Becoming a web developer requires no formal education or training.

    Correct Viewpoint: While it is possible to become a web developer without any formal education, most employers prefer candidates with at least some college-level coursework in computer science, programming languages, and software development. Additionally, many employers require certifications or other qualifications that demonstrate the applicant’s knowledge of web development technologies.
  2. Mistake: It takes only a few months to become an experienced web developer.

    Correct Viewpoint: Becoming an experienced web developer typically takes several years of practice and experience working on various projects and platforms before one can be considered proficient in the field. Even then, there are always new technologies being developed that require ongoing learning and adaptation for developers to stay up-to-date with industry trends.